// Copyright (c) 2015-present Mattermost, Inc. All Rights Reserved.
|
|
// See License.txt for license information.
|
|
|
|
package utils
|
|
|
|
import (
|
|
"crypto/sha256"
|
|
"encoding/base64"
|
|
"fmt"
|
|
"io/ioutil"
|
|
"net/url"
|
|
"os"
|
|
"path"
|
|
"path/filepath"
|
|
"regexp"
|
|
"strings"
|
|
|
|
"github.com/pkg/errors"
|
|
|
|
"github.com/mattermost/mattermost-server/mlog"
|
|
"github.com/mattermost/mattermost-server/model"
|
|
)
|
|
|
|
// UpdateAssetsSubpath rewrites assets in the /client directory to assume the application is hosted
|
|
// at the given subpath instead of at the root. No changes are written unless necessary.
|
|
func UpdateAssetsSubpath(subpath string) error {
|
|
if subpath == "" {
|
|
subpath = "/"
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
staticDir, found := FindDir(model.CLIENT_DIR)
|
|
if !found {
|
|
return errors.New("failed to find client dir")
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
staticDir, err := filepath.EvalSymlinks(staticDir)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
return errors.Wrapf(err, "failed to resolve symlinks to %s", staticDir)
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
rootHtmlPath := filepath.Join(staticDir, "root.html")
|
|
oldRootHtml, err := ioutil.ReadFile(rootHtmlPath)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
return errors.Wrap(err, "failed to open root.html")
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
pathToReplace := "/static/"
|
|
newPath := path.Join(subpath, "static") + "/"
|
|
|
|
// Determine if a previous subpath had already been rewritten into the assets.
|
|
reWebpackPublicPathScript := regexp.MustCompile("window.publicPath='([^']+)'")
|
|
alreadyRewritten := false
|
|
if matches := reWebpackPublicPathScript.FindStringSubmatch(string(oldRootHtml)); matches != nil {
|
|
pathToReplace = matches[1]
|
|
alreadyRewritten = true
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if pathToReplace == newPath {
|
|
mlog.Debug("No rewrite required for static assets", mlog.String("path", pathToReplace))
|
|
return nil
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
mlog.Debug("Rewriting static assets", mlog.String("from_path", pathToReplace), mlog.String("to_path", newPath))
|
|
|
|
newRootHtml := string(oldRootHtml)
|
|
|
|
// Compute the sha256 hash for the inline script and reference same in the CSP meta tag.
|
|
// This allows the inline script defining `window.publicPath` to bypass CSP protections.
|
|
script := fmt.Sprintf("window.publicPath='%s'", newPath)
|
|
scriptHash := sha256.Sum256([]byte(script))
|
|
|
|
reCSP := regexp.MustCompile(`<meta http-equiv=Content-Security-Policy content="script-src 'self' cdn.segment.com/analytics.js/ 'unsafe-eval'([^"]*)">`)
|
|
newRootHtml = reCSP.ReplaceAllLiteralString(newRootHtml, fmt.Sprintf(
|
|
`<meta http-equiv=Content-Security-Policy content="script-src 'self' cdn.segment.com/analytics.js/ 'unsafe-eval' 'sha256-%s'">`,
|
|
base64.StdEncoding.EncodeToString(scriptHash[:]),
|
|
))
|
|
|
|
// Rewrite the root.html references to `/static/*` to include the given subpath. This
|
|
// potentially includes a previously injected inline script.
|
|
newRootHtml = strings.Replace(newRootHtml, pathToReplace, newPath, -1)
|
|
|
|
// Inject the script, if needed, to define `window.publicPath`.
|
|
if !alreadyRewritten {
|
|
newRootHtml = strings.Replace(newRootHtml, "</style>", fmt.Sprintf("</style><script>%s</script>", script), 1)
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Write out the updated root.html.
|
|
if err = ioutil.WriteFile(rootHtmlPath, []byte(newRootHtml), 0); err != nil {
|
|
return errors.Wrapf(err, "failed to update root.html with subpath %s", subpath)
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// Rewrite the manifest.json and *.css references to `/static/*` (or a previously rewritten subpath).
|
|
err = filepath.Walk(staticDir, func(walkPath string, info os.FileInfo, err error) error {
|
|
if filepath.Base(walkPath) == "manifest.json" || filepath.Ext(walkPath) == ".css" {
|
|
if old, err := ioutil.ReadFile(walkPath); err != nil {
|
|
return errors.Wrapf(err, "failed to open %s", walkPath)
|
|
} else {
|
|
new := strings.Replace(string(old), pathToReplace, newPath, -1)
|
|
if err = ioutil.WriteFile(walkPath, []byte(new), 0); err != nil {
|
|
return errors.Wrapf(err, "failed to update %s with subpath %s", walkPath, subpath)
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return nil
|
|
})
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
return errors.Wrapf(err, "error walking %s", staticDir)
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return nil
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// UpdateAssetsSubpathFromConfig uses UpdateAssetsSubpath and any path defined in the SiteURL.
|
|
func UpdateAssetsSubpathFromConfig(config *model.Config) error {
|
|
// Don't rewrite in development environments, since webpack in developer mode constantly
|
|
// updates the assets and must be configured separately.
|
|
if model.BuildNumber == "dev" {
|
|
mlog.Debug("Skipping update to assets subpath since dev build")
|
|
return nil
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
subpath, err := GetSubpathFromConfig(config)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
return err
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return UpdateAssetsSubpath(subpath)
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
func GetSubpathFromConfig(config *model.Config) (string, error) {
|
|
if config == nil {
|
|
return "", errors.New("no config provided")
|
|
} else if config.ServiceSettings.SiteURL == nil {
|
|
return "/", nil
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
u, err := url.Parse(*config.ServiceSettings.SiteURL)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
return "", errors.Wrap(err, "failed to parse SiteURL from config")
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if u.Path == "" {
|
|
return "/", nil
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return path.Clean(u.Path), nil
|
|
}
